Overview

Postcode WF12 9HB is located in a major urban area, within the Dewsbury South ward of Kirklees in the Yorkshire and The Humber region, and forms part of the Ravensthorpe area. It has very high deprivation and high crime levels, with around 78.9 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, about 30% below the Yorkshire and The Humber average of 113 per 1,000. The average income per household in Ravensthorpe is £42,700 per year. The nearest station is Ravensthorpe, about 0.7 miles away. There are 6 primary and no secondary schools in the area.

Frequently asked questions about WF12 9HB

Is WF12 9HB (Ravensthorpe) safe?

The area around WF12 9HB records about 79 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, which is a high crime rate for England: it scores 7 out of 10 on the Area360 crime scale, where 10 is the highest crime level. Across Yorkshire and The Humber as a whole the rate is about 113 per 1,000. The most common offences locally are violence and sexual offences, anti-social behaviour and public order.

What is the average house price near WF12 9HB?

The median sale price around WF12 9HB in Dewsbury South is £190,000 (about £211 per square foot) based on 105 registered sales according to HM Land Registry data.

What schools are near WF12 9HB?

There are 11 schools close to WF12 9HB, including Thornhill Lees Church of England Voluntary Controlled Infant and Nursery School (Good), Ravenshall School (Outstanding) and Headfield Church of England Voluntary Controlled Junior School (Good). Ratings are from the latest Ofsted inspections.

What is the nearest station to WF12 9HB?

The closest station to WF12 9HB is Ravensthorpe, about 1,169 m away.

How deprived is the area around WF12 9HB?

WF12 9HB scores 9 out of 10 on the deprivation scale, where 10 is the most deprived. Its neighbourhood ranks 5,482 of 32,844 in England on the official Index of Multiple Deprivation (rank 1 is the most deprived).

Who represents WF12 9HB (Ravensthorpe) in Parliament and on the local council?

The Member of Parliament for Dewsbury and Batley covering WF12 9HB is Iqbal Mohamed (Independent), elected at the 2024 general election. The area is represented by 1 local councillor: Hanifa Darwan (Independent).
